Feanor has posted some SATA and PATA benchmarks taken using his ASUS A7N8X:

“A lot of people have been curious about using SATA converters, so I thought I’d post some benchmarks using both PATA and SATA with a single WD 800JB. I am using the soyo converter and I found that the CF1-3 jumper settings do make a difference, setting the jumpers to 100 MHz/Mbps did lower the max transfer speed (it says MHz in the manual and Mbps on the back of the card). As you can see, there is not a whole lot of difference. I ran each setting three times and these are about average. Do these look about right?”
